Transaction 457e921ba54215243433e7c8fbec0aa285546ca5ccb7cb48288405869c106ecc
1 Input
2 Outputs
- 457e921ba54215243433e7c8fbec0aa285546ca5ccb7cb48288405869c106ecc:0
- 457e921ba54215243433e7c8fbec0aa285546ca5ccb7cb48288405869c106ecc:1
value 349000
address 1FCetQQP3TcRafQL4gb2rNuRs7oguCUwn4
value 27562020
address 3FzfHRCoF2Xy5Nq96gYurEK5C1hfWgzibQ